Telecom Ministry Calls Cabinet to Implement Maadi Park with PPP by Nov

The Egyptian Telecom Ministry is planning to address the Cabinet in order to begin offering Cairo Contact park in Maadi zone throughout public private partnerships (PPP) within the coming month.

Eng. Mohamed AbdelWahab, Chairman at Cairo Contact Centers Park in Maadi, said the board of directors has finalized all the required measures of the project, pointing out that it has obtained the approval of participation between the two sectors of the Finance Ministry, in addition waiting to offer the project on the Cabinet so as to start pumping investments by the private sector.

AbdelWahab has asserted that the zone is representing Eng. Atef Helmy, Egyptian Telecom Minister will hold a meeting with the Cabinet in order to take new phases for offering the project with the two sectors during the current month after obtaining PPP approval of the Finance Ministry.

The initial study by the International Finance Corporation (IFC) and Financial consultants at Ernst young ,technical consultant, WSP, and legal consultant, TOWERS HAMLINS.

It is worth mentioning that the Cairo Contact investments in Maadi zone established by the Prime Minister’s decision in March 2008, on an area of 75 feddan.

The Egypt’s Post has 5 technological buildings in this main phase with investments up EGP300million, as it will provide around 5000 direct job opportunities and 12 K indirect job opportunities.

It is schedule to implement investment phases and to establish 27 new buildings to make the number of buildings reach 38.
